    Unlock Bigger Savings: foodpanda PRO Weeks offers up to 50% off for subscribers

    PhilSTAR Tech TeamBy PhilSTAR Tech TeamSeptember 2, 20252 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    foodpanda is rolling out its biggest discount event yet with PRO Weeks, a two-week savings bonanza exclusive to pandapro subscribers. Running from September 1 to 15, the campaign offers massive discounts on meals, groceries, and essentials—giving subscribers more reasons to stick with (or sign up for) pandapro.

    According to Pat Jacinto, Growth and Marketing Director of foodpanda Philippines, the event highlights the brand’s goal: “Our goal with pandapro is to make ordering online more affordable and convenient for our customers. PRO Weeks is our way of providing even greater value on the meals and essentials people already love, reinforcing why a pandapro membership is the smartest way to save.”

    What subscribers can expect during PRO Weeks:

    • Up to 50% off from select foodpanda restaurant and grocery partners
    • Free delivery from popular restaurants across the app
    • Pandamart savings with up to 50% off on a wide range of items
    • Special shop discounts, such as ₱140 off at Robinsons Supermarket and ₱100 off at Puregold

    Why join pandapro?

    Even outside PRO Weeks, members enjoy perks like:

    • Unlimited free delivery
    • Exclusive vouchers and promo codes
    • Discounts from thousands of restaurants and stores

    Subscription is flexible and affordable, starting at ₱33.30 per month with the 12-month plan. Signing up is easy: just open the foodpanda app, tap the pandapro section, select a plan, and complete checkout.

    With up to 50% savings, free delivery, and exclusive deals, PRO Weeks makes pandapro a must-have for anyone who orders in regularly—whether it’s your favorite fast food, pantry staples, or a midnight snack.
